Eligibility Requirements
- This course is open to all licensed health care practitioners whose Scope of Practice permits the use of dry needling.
- All participants must sign consent forms permitting the other participants to practice and perform dry needling on them and permitting the instructor to demonstrate dry needling on them.
- All participants must provide proof of adequate malpractice insurance.
- All participants must sign a waiver absolving the instructor of any liability in the event of injury.
- All participants must be prepared to dress down into shorts and women should wear halter type tops to allow adequate exposure for practice during the training
